Transaction 933a0a1288601359a4d6bb84f359261391b65a3942444fc8c411aca412265261
1 Input
1 Output
-
933a0a1288601359a4d6bb84f359261391b65a3942444fc8c411aca412265261:0
- value
- 2065187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44928f08a3820d6d876625459c0db31481beb6d7 OP_EQUAL
- address
- 37wbSfe2b9q3mnWPjrrbCUcB86yhvzcbzL